2021 MYR to EUR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2021

During 2021, the MYR to EUR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 22, valuing the pair at 0.2125.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 25, dropping to 0.1971.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0154 EUR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.2035 to the December average rate of 0.2100,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.19%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2021 high of 0.2125 was down 4.77% compared to the 2020 peak of 0.2232,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

MYR to EUR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.2026, compared to 0.2056 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0030 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 0.2026
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 0.2056
